Introduction: The Understory – A World of Shadows and Secrets
The understory, situated between the forest floor and the canopy, is a complex habitat characterized by moderate light penetration, high humidity, and a dense layer of vegetation including shrubs, herbs, and saplings. This unique environment supports a rich community of animals, vastly different from those inhabiting the canopy or the forest floor. Now, these animals have evolved remarkable adaptations to thrive in this often shadowy realm, showcasing nature's incredible ingenuity. From tiny insects to elusive mammals, the understory is a vibrant tapestry of life, showcasing the interconnectedness of the forest ecosystem.
Animal Adaptations in the Understory Environment
Life in the understory presents unique challenges. The relatively low light levels, the need to figure out dense vegetation, and the presence of predators all demand specialized adaptations. Let's explore some key adaptations:
Camouflage and Crypsis:
Many understory animals rely on camouflage to avoid predators and ambush prey. Also, think of the leaf-tailed geckos of Madagascar, masters of disguise, blending easily with their surroundings. Similarly, many insects exhibit remarkable mimicry, mimicking leaves, twigs, or even bird droppings for protection. This crypsis, or the ability to remain hidden, is essential for survival in a world where predators are ever-present.
Specialized Sensory Systems:
Low light levels necessitate heightened sensory capabilities. So many understory dwellers have exceptional hearing or smell. Owls, for example, possess exceptional night vision and hearing, allowing them to hunt effectively in the low-light conditions of the understory. Similarly, many small mammals rely on their acute sense of smell to locate food and avoid danger.
Locomotion Adaptations:
Navigating the dense undergrowth demands specialized locomotion. But Snakes with slender bodies easily weave through tangled vegetation, while primates with agile limbs and grasping hands and feet are adept climbers. Insects, with their diverse array of legs and wings, can exploit a wide range of microhabitats within the understory.
Dietary Adaptations:
The understory provides a diverse range of food sources. Herbivores have evolved specialized digestive systems to handle the tough leaves and stems of understory plants. Carnivores, meanwhile, have adapted to hunt a variety of prey, from insects and reptiles to small mammals. The diversity of food sources supports a complex food web, contributing to the overall biodiversity of the understory.
Thermoregulation:
Maintaining body temperature can be challenging in the understory’s fluctuating microclimates. Some animals are ectothermic, relying on external sources of heat, while others are endothermic, generating their own body heat. The latter often exhibit adaptations like thicker fur or feathers to insulate against cooler temperatures.
Key Animal Groups of the Understory
The understory is home to a surprising variety of animal groups, each playing a vital role in the ecosystem.
Insects: A Foundation of the Understory Ecosystem
Insects form the backbone of the understory food web. From leaf-eating caterpillars and sap-sucking aphids to predatory mantids and spiders, they contribute to nutrient cycling, pollination, and as a vital food source for other animals. The diversity of insect life in the understory is staggering, with many species remaining undescribed.
Amphibians: Masters of Damp Environments
The damp conditions of the understory are ideal for amphibians. Frogs, toads, and salamanders thrive here, relying on the moist environment for reproduction and hydration. Many are cryptic, blending easily into the leaf litter and vegetation.
Reptiles: Diversity in Form and Function
Reptiles, including snakes, lizards, and turtles, occupy various niches within the understory. Snakes often hunt small mammals, amphibians, and other reptiles, while lizards may be insectivores or herbivores. Turtles, depending on the species, may be terrestrial or semi-aquatic, contributing to the overall diversity of the understory community.
Birds: A Variety of Niches
While many birds inhabit the canopy, several species frequent the understory for foraging or nesting. Which means Ground-feeding birds, such as certain species of wrens and thrushes, search for insects and seeds amongst the leaf litter. Other birds may use the dense vegetation for cover or nesting sites.

Mammals: A Spectrum of Sizes and Behaviors
The understory supports a diverse range of mammals, from tiny shrews and voles to larger animals like deer and wild cats. Which means small mammals often rely on the understory for shelter and foraging, while larger animals may use it for movement or hunting. Nocturnal mammals are particularly well-represented in the understory, utilizing their enhanced senses to deal with and hunt in low-light conditions.
The Ecological Roles of Understory Animals
Understory animals play crucial ecological roles:
- Nutrient Cycling: Decomposers like insects and fungi break down organic matter, releasing nutrients back into the soil.
- Pollination: Insects, particularly bees and butterflies, play a vital role in pollinating understory plants.
- Seed Dispersal: Animals like birds and mammals disperse seeds, contributing to plant diversity and regeneration.
- Predator-Prey Dynamics: The complex predator-prey relationships within the understory maintain population balance and community stability.
Threats to Understory Animals and Conservation
Understory animals face numerous threats, many stemming from human activities:
- Habitat Loss and Fragmentation: Deforestation, agriculture, and urbanization are destroying and fragmenting understory habitats, leading to population declines and extinctions.
- Climate Change: Changes in temperature and precipitation patterns can disrupt the delicate balance of the understory ecosystem, affecting the survival of many species.
- Invasive Species: Invasive plants and animals can outcompete native species, disrupting the food web and reducing biodiversity.
- Pollution: Pesticides, herbicides, and other pollutants can have devastating effects on understory animals.
Conservation efforts are vital to protect the biodiversity of the understory:
- Protected Areas: Establishing and maintaining protected areas is crucial for preserving understory habitats and the animals that depend on them.
- Sustainable Forestry Practices: Implementing sustainable logging practices can minimize habitat loss and fragmentation.
- Invasive Species Control: Controlling invasive species can help to protect native understory animals.
- Climate Change Mitigation: Reducing greenhouse gas emissions is essential for mitigating the impacts of climate change on understory ecosystems.
- Research and Monitoring: Ongoing research and monitoring are essential for understanding the needs of understory animals and developing effective conservation strategies.
Frequently Asked Questions (FAQ)
Q: Are all understory animals nocturnal?
A: No, while many understory animals are nocturnal, many are also diurnal (active during the day). The level of light and the specific adaptations of each species will influence their activity patterns.
Q: How do understory animals adapt to low light levels?
A: Understory animals have evolved a range of adaptations to deal with low light levels, including enhanced hearing and smell, larger eyes, and specialized photoreceptor cells in their eyes for better night vision.
Q: What is the importance of the understory for the overall forest ecosystem?
A: The understory plays a vital role in the overall forest ecosystem, supporting a high level of biodiversity, contributing to nutrient cycling, and influencing the forest's structure and function.
Q: What can I do to help protect understory animals?
A: You can help protect understory animals by supporting organizations involved in forest conservation, reducing your carbon footprint, and avoiding the use of harmful pesticides and herbicides. You can also advocate for policies that protect forests and their inhabitants.
